Please can someone tell me, do i have to pay IP's upfront for IVS's or does it come out of the agreed monthly payments?

Post by Oliver » Fri Jan 12, 2007 9:25 am
IP fees are paid out of the monthly amount you put towards your IVA. This is your Disposable income which is made up of your total income less all your reasonable living costs.

Post by MelanieGiles » Fri Jan 12, 2007 5:44 pm
Hi Ian

It really depends on what you agree with your actual IP. Oliver has highlighted the usual way our fees are paid, but you may find an IP who will charge you up front for the work. I suggest that you avoid these firms, as an IP worth their onions will not take work on which they know there is a risk of not getting paid for. So if they are prepared to run your case there is a good chance of acceptance on the day.
